What Are Cataracts?



If you have actually ever before wondered what causes over cast vision as you age, the answer might very well be cataracts. Cataracts are a common eye problem that impacts the clarity of the lens inside your eye. The lens is generally clear, permitting light to pass through and concentrate on the retina. However, as you age, healthy proteins in the lens can clump together, triggering cloudiness and obstructing the passage of light. This cloudiness brings about blurred vision, difficulty seeing at night, level of sensitivity to light, and faded shades. In time, cataracts can substantially impact your vision, making everyday activities challenging.


Cataracts can develop in one or both eyes and normally progression gradually.

Treatment Options



Discovering therapy choices for cataracts introduces a series of efficient interventions that can help boost your vision and lifestyle. In the early stages of cataracts, upgrading your glasses prescription or using brighter illumination may aid manage signs. However, as the cataracts development and start to interfere with day-to-day tasks, surgery becomes the key therapy choice.
